'They give so much and demand so little' - Remembering Dame Olivia Newton-John's extraordinary love for animals

Dame Olivia Newton-John was the legendary performer who stole the hearts of millions when she took on the role of Sandy in the megahit musical 'Grease' back in 1978 opposite John Travolta and sold 100 million records worldwide in a showbiz career that lasted more than 50 years. But away from the spotlight, Olivia - who lost a 30-year-battle with cancer on Monday (08.08.22) at her ranch in California - was hopelessly devoted to caring for animals.
